Antique French Kakiemon Porcelain Tureens, 18th Century
Antique French Kakiemon Porcelain Tureens, 18th Century

Antique French Kakiemon Porcelain Tureens, 18th Century

By Chantilly

Located in Katonah, NY

A pair of antique 18th century French porcelain sugar tureens and trays made by the Chantilly manufactory in the Japanese Kakiemon style circa 1735-1745. Our pair of charming sauce tureens with their trays, feature a palette of strong, bright colors painted on a pure milky-white base. They are an exquisite example of the porcelains produced at Chantilly. Following the Kakiemon tradition the design was sparsely applied to emphasize the quality of the porcelain body. We were thrilled to find this pair as excellent French Kakiemon porcelains are something we always look for but rarely find. This pair are perfect ! And they are a work of design perfection. The delicate renditions of flowery branches and insects are strategically placed on a magnificently conceived four-lobed tray. The placement highlights the purity of the soft white background. The cover of each tureen is similarly decorated and is completed by a foliate form handle of three petunia-like flowers. In our opinion this porcelain is unsurpassed in sheer elegance and beauty. Each piece is marked on the base with the Chantilly red hunting horn mark. References: For an image and description see "Porcelaine Tendre...
